Zaporizhzhya Nuclear Power Plant switches to minimum operating power following supply network damage
Zaporizhzhya NPP has had to slash its electricity use following damage to the electricity supply, cutting back to the minimum it needs to operate
Energoatom shared this information in Telegram.
"Due to damage to the 330 kV high-voltage line in South Ukraine, the Zaporizhzhya NPP was turned to the minimum power level to ensure the stable operation of the energy system, which only provides power to its own needs", the report says.
